What is car racing?

Car racing is a competitive motorsport where drivers race automobiles against each other on tracks, roads, or closed circuits. The objective is to complete a set distance or number of laps in the shortest time possible, often requiring both speed and skillful maneuvering. Car racing includes various types, such as Formula 1, NASCAR, rally racing, and endurance racing, each with unique rules and vehicle specifications. It's a globally popular sport, known for its adrenaline rush, technical innovation, and passionate fan base.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Professional Race Car Driver,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Professional Race Car Driver, you need expert driving skills, deep knowledge of vehicle dynamics, and often a background in competitive racing or racing schools for formal training. Familiarity with telemetry systems, data analysis tools, and experience with different types of race cars and simulators are commonly required. Exceptional focus, quick decision-making, teamwork, and resilience under pressure are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ities are vital for ensuring peak performance, safety, and effective collaboration with teams in high-stakes racing environments.

What are some common challenges car racing drivers face during a typical race season?

Car racing drivers often encounter challenges such as adapting to varying track conditions, maintaining peak physical and mental fitness, and working closely with their pit crew to optimize vehicle performance. They must also manage the stress of competition and the risk of on-track incidents, all while consistently delivering strong results for their team and sponsors. Building effective communication with engineers and teammates is crucial for strategic decision-making and continuous improvement throughout the season.

How to get into a car racing career?

To pursue a career in car racing, aspiring drivers typically start by gaining experience in karting or lower-level racing series, developing driving skills, and understanding race strategies. Many racers also obtain racing licenses through recognized organizations and seek sponsorship or team opportunities to advance to higher levels of competition.

What jobs involve racing cars?

Jobs that involve racing cars include professional race car drivers, who compete in motorsport events such as Formula 1, NASCAR, and rally racing. These roles require driving skills, physical fitness, and often a racing license or certification; other related jobs include race engineers, mechanics, and team managers who support racing teams in preparation and strategy.

How much money do car racers make?

Car racers' earnings vary widely based on experience, skill level, and competition level. Top professional race car drivers can earn millions annually through prize money, sponsorships, and endorsements, while many lower-tier racers earn modest incomes or supplement racing with other jobs.

Position Overview

As an Automotive Detailer at CarMax, you’ll play a vital role in delivering vehicles that exceed customer expectations. CarMax customers trust us for cars that look and feel like new, and your expertise ensures every vehicle meets our industry-leading quality standards. Working with a skilled team in a modern, climate-controlled facility, you’ll handle everything from paint touch-ups and interior detailing to waxing and buffing. We provide paid training, career growth opportunities, and a comprehensive benefits package including medical coverage, retirement plans, paid time off, and exclusive car purchase discounts. Join CarMax and help us create an exceptional experience for every customer.

Why CarMax?

At CarMax, we are the nation’s largest retailer of used cars with stores from coast to coast, and we are still growing. We’re rethinking the way people buy cars – and our associates help us do just that. We believe work should feel meaningful and rewarding, with opportunities to make an impact every day. Whether you’re advancing your career or growing your skillset, we are here to drive you forward.

Role Responsibilities

  • Perform thorough cosmetic inspections to identify detailing needs and ensure vehicles meet CarMax quality standards
  • Repair and replace small components, ensuring functionality and visual appeal
  • Execute paint retouching, post-paint finishing, waxing, and buffing to CarMax quality standards
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ment while following CarMax protocols
  • Collaborate with team members to meet production goals and deliver exceptional customer satisfaction
  • Follow CarMax Environmental, Health and Safety (EH&S) requirements and maintain a clean and orderly work area.

Required Qualifications

  • Strong manual dexterity and physical stamina to lift heavy objects and stand for extended periods
  • Exceptional attention to detail and commitment to customer satisfaction
  • Valid driver’s license and ability to operate vehicles safely

Preferred Qualifications

  • Hands-on experience in automotive detailing tasks such as washing, waxing, buffing, masking, sanding, and minor paint applications
  • Familiarity with replacing small parts and performing minor cosmetic repairs
